How to Survive a Two-Wave Hold-Down
___________________________________________________________




  1. Bail your board.

  2. Avoid surfacing in the white water after a wave crashes.

  3. Do not struggle--you will become exhausted.

  4. Dive as deep as you can.

  5. Let the first wave pass over you.

  6. Follow the board's leash to the surface.

  7. Wait out the waves by diving underneath them.
    Curl your body into a defensive ball as the waves pass overhead.

  8. Paddle to calmer water.
